Интересное в .NET #26

Привет. Сейчас средина лета, многие в отпусках, но а я рад представить очередную подборку интересных статей, которые вы можете прочитать в свободное время, даже будучи в отпуске.

 

18 хитростей для работы с Visual Studio

В статье рассказывается про некоторые очевидные и не очень вещи, которые могут упростить использование Visual Studio для разработчиков.

 

Getting Started with Docker in Visual Studio 2019

О том, как легко начать работать с Docker используя Visual Studio 2019. Старт использования Docker максимально прост, поэтому в статье очень много изображений, наглядно демонстрирующих сам процесс.

 

Certificate Authentication in ASP.NET Core 3.0

О том как начать использовать аутентификацию через сертификаты при использовании ASP.NET Core 3.

 

Почему, зачем и когда нужно использовать ValueTask

Суть статьи отражён в заголовке. Дано разъяснение, когда будет выгодно использовать тип ValueTask в асинхронных методах.

 

Try the new System.Text.Json APIs

В .NET Core 3.0 добавлено новое пространство имён System.Text.Json в данной статье дано описание того зачем это было сделано и как с ним можно работать.

 

Асинхронное программирование – производительность async: понять расходы на async и await

При всех преимуществах асинхронного программирования нужно понимать, что на использование async/await так же будут задействованы ресурсы. Как это может влиять на производительность можно узнать из статьи.

 

Lock с приоритетами в .NET

Пример реализации примитива синхронизации Lock, способного работать с приоритетами. Помимо описания дана ссылка на GitHub, где можно ознакомиться с исходным кодом.

 

Если у вас есть на примете интересная статья, которая может быть полезной — пишите любым удобным для вас способом.

Приятного программирования.

Добавить комментарий